Abstract

The invention discloses an acne removing composition with acne mark removing and scar removing effects, and relates to the technical field of skin care products. The composition comprises Scutellariae radix extract, cortex Phellodendri extract, Coptidis rhizoma root extract and herba Centellae extract. The preparation method comprises the following steps: (1) drying radix Scutellariae, cortex Phellodendri, rhizoma Coptidis, and herba Centellae, and pulverizing to obtain plant powder; (2) adding water, butanediol and 1, 2-pentanediol into the plant powder obtained in the step (1), extracting and filtering. The composition has effects of removing acne mark, removing acne scar, controlling oil and removing acne. The function purposes, the function routes and the function mechanisms of each component in the composition are different, and the components show the optimal synergistic effect when in proper dosage proportion. The preparation method can improve the active components of the extract and improve the effect.

Background
Acne is also called "comedo" and "face blister" in medicine, commonly known as "whelk" and "pimple", and is a very common chronic inflammation of sebaceous glands and hair follicles. It is good at the facial surfaces of young men and women, especially at the forehead, cheeks and chin, and also at the parts with abundant sebaceous glands such as chest, shoulder and back. Under normal conditions, the sebaceous glands secrete a proper amount of grease, and the grease reaches the surface of the skin to achieve the effect of moistening the skin. When skin sebaceous glands are stimulated by stimulation factors (androgen, spicy greasy food, menstruation, mental stress and the like), excessive sebum is secreted, horny layers fall out and are disordered, skin metabolism disorder is caused, old waste horny substances are accumulated, sebum cannot be smoothly discharged, the phenomenon of hair follicle blockage and the like is caused, a closed environment is caused after a hair follicle opening is blocked, acne can be formed, an anoxic state appears in the hair follicle, a growth environment is created for anaerobic propionibacterium acnes, the propionibacterium acnes starts to excessively reproduce, inflammatory substances are gathered by metabolic products of the propionibacterium acnes, inflammatory acne can be formed, pigmentation caused by inflammation often leaves marks on the skin after the acne is eliminated, and the inflammatory reaction of skin cells causes damage to skin tissues at the same time, so that scars are generated. in one aspect, the invention provides an acne-removing composition with acne mark-removing and scar-removing effects, which comprises a scutellaria baicalensis root extract, a phellodendron amurense bark extract, a coptis chinensis root extract and a centella asiatica extract.
Preferably, the acne-removing composition is prepared from 1-10:1-10:1-10:1-10 by mass of radix scutellariae, cortex phellodendri bark, rhizoma coptidis and centella asiatica; further preferred are scutellaria root, phellodendron bark, coptis root and centella asiatica in a mass ratio of 5:3:3: 6.
"centella asiatica" refers to the whole plant of centella asiatica.
The baicalein, baicalin and other components contained in the scutellaria baicalensis roots influence the metabolism of arachidonic acid through various links, and inhibit the generation of prostaglandin E (PGE) and Leukotriene (LT) to different degrees, thereby relieving the expansion of blood vessels by inflammatory mediators, increasing the permeability of blood vessel walls and chemotactic effect of white blood cells; baicalin also has extremely high inhibitory activity on melanocytes, can remarkably inhibit the generation of lipid peroxide, and can relieve melanin pigmentation;
the phellodendron amurense bark has an anti-inflammatory effect, can directly support the muscle bottom to relieve pockmarks, can promote the generation of collagen to repair scars, combines the oxidation resistance of the collagen, and keeps the skin stable; cortex Phellodendri bark containing berberine, phellodendrine, obacunone, etc. has inhibitory effect on Staphylococcus aureus, Staphylococcus albus, Staphylococcus citricola, Diplococcus pneumoniae, Diplococcus meningitidis, Streptococcus viridis, Vibrio cholerae, Bacillus diphtheriae, Bacillus dysenteriae, Pseudomonas aeruginosa, etc.
The rhizoma coptidis root related by the invention contains various active ingredients such as coptisine and jateorhizine. Has remarkable antibacterial effect on gram-positive bacteria such as staphylococcus aureus, streptococcus pneumoniae, beta lactamase-producing streptococcus pneumoniae and the like, gram-negative bacteria such as pseudomonas aeruginosa, escherichia coli, drug-resistant acinetobacter baumannii, neisseria gonorrhoeae and the like, and fungi such as candida albicans, candida albicans and the like, and can balance grease.
The centella asiatica extract is rich in terpenoids, can obviously improve the content of collagen and cell layer fibronectin (fibronectin is widely involved in the processes of cell migration, adhesion, proliferation, hemostasis, skin tissue repair and the like), and can stimulate and promote the generation of type I and type III collagen, activate fibroblast genes and improve and repair the barrier function of the skin; can promote wound healing and scar repair, and reduce inflammatory reaction. In addition, the centella asiatica extract can reduce the production of proinflammatory mediators (IL-1, MMP-1), and improve and repair the barrier function of the skin.
On the other hand, the invention provides a preparation method of the acne-removing composition, which comprises the following steps:
(1) drying radix Scutellariae, cortex Phellodendri, rhizoma Coptidis, and herba Centellae, and pulverizing to obtain plant powder;
(2) adding water, butanediol and 1, 2-pentanediol into the plant powder obtained in the step (1), extracting and filtering.
Preferably, in the step (1), the pulverization is to 10-50 mesh.
Preferably, in the step (2), the mass ratio of the plant powder to the water, the butanediol and the 1, 2-pentanediol is 10-30:30-70:30-70:1-10, and is further preferably 17:50:50: 5.
Preferably, in the step (2), the extraction is performed by a low-temperature high-pressure difference method, and specifically comprises the following steps: regulating temperature to 30-50 deg.C, pressurizing to 50-100MPa, and soaking and extracting under stirring for 30-60 min.
The low-temperature high-pressure difference method is characterized in that loss of thermosensitive components can be avoided under low-temperature conditions, the solvent can more easily permeate into the plant powder under high-pressure conditions, effective components can be rapidly dissolved in the solvent, and tests prove that the extract obtained by the low-temperature high-pressure difference method has higher active components and better effect.

Test example 1 anti-Propionibacterium acnes Effect
Propionibacterium acnes is the primary pathogen that causes acne. In the antibacterial experiment, propionibacterium acnes is used as a bacterial model, and in order to verify the antibacterial effect of the composition, the compositions in the embodiments 1 to 3 and the comparative examples 1 to 7 of the invention are subjected to antibacterial performance measurement by referring to GB15979-2002 (hygienic Standard for Disposable sanitary articles) appendix C4 'test method for antibacterial performance of dissolution antibacterial (inhibiting) products':
1) test samples: the compositions described in examples 1-3 and comparative examples 1-7 were diluted to 2% dilutions, respectively.
2) Preparation of bacterial suspension: a24-hour culture of the propionibacterium acnes is washed by 0.03mol/L phosphate buffer solution to prepare 104-106CFU/mL bacterial suspension.
3) Respectively taking 1g of test sample, adding 0.1mL of the bacterial suspension, uniformly coating and mixing, starting timing, adding 9mL of 0.03mol/L phosphate buffer solution after 20min, fully and uniformly mixing, taking 3 dilutions, respectively taking 1mL of the dilutions, placing the dilutions in two parallel plates, adding corresponding culture medium, and culturing for 24 hours at 36 +/-1 ℃ under anaerobic condition to count bacterial colonies. The above experiment was repeated 3 times, and the average was taken and a blank control group was set.
The calculation formula of the bacteriostatic rate is as follows: and X is (A-B)/A X100%, wherein X is the bacteriostasis rate, A is the average recovered colony of a blank control sample, and B is the average recovered colony of a test sample.
The evaluation criteria for efficacy were: (1) the effect is obvious when the bacteriostasis rate is more than or equal to 90 percent; (2) the bacteriostatic rate is 40-90% and the effect is normal; (3) the bacteriostasis rate is less than 40 percent, which indicates no effect. The results are shown in the following table.
TABLE 1 antibacterial (Propionibacterium acnes) test results
Group of Propionibacterium acnes inhibition rate (%) Evaluation of efficacy
Example 1 90 The effect is obvious
Example 2 91 The effect is obvious
Example 3 94 The effect is obvious
Comparative example 1 42 General effects
Comparative example 2 48 General effects
Comparative example 3 53 General effects
Comparative example 4 40 General effects
Comparative example 5 42 General effects
Comparative example 6 68 General effects
Comparative example 7 40 General effects
As can be seen from Table 1, the compositions of examples 1 to 3 have an obvious bacteriostatic effect on Propionibacterium acnes, and the compositions of comparative examples 1 to 7 have a general bacteriostatic effect; experiments show that the scutellaria baicalensis roots, the phellodendron amurense barks, the coptis roots and the centella asiatica can obviously inhibit the proliferation of propionibacterium acnes when being used in a combined way according to a proper proportion, and the inhibition effect is better than that when the components are used independently; can effectively prevent or improve the acne symptom of the skin.

Test example 4 irritation test (Patch test)
Test samples: oil-controlling acne-removing gel prepared in examples 4-6 and commercially available acne-removing products of comparative examples 14-15.
Subject: selecting 30 volunteers (the same batch of subjects is used for each test sample);
the test method comprises the following steps: a closed test is adopted, 0.02g of test sample is placed in a patch applicator, a hypoallergenic adhesive tape is applied to the arm curve side of a tested subject, the test area is at least 5 x 5cm, the tested subject straightens the arm when applying, the test sample is applied from the lower part to the upper part, the adhesive tape is lightly pressed by the palm to discharge air, the test sample is tightly attached to the skin for 24 hours, and the blank control group is a test sample which is not used.
And (4) observing results: the patch was removed 30min and then interpreted according to the interpretation criteria described below, and the statistical test results are shown in the table below.
Interpretation criteria: (one) negative reaction; (+ -suspicious reaction: only mild erythema; (+) weak positive: erythema, infiltrates, and possibly small amounts of papules; strong positive (++): erythema, infiltrates, papules, blisters; (+++) very positive: erythema, infiltrates, papules, blisters, bulla.
TABLE 15 irritation test records
Test item Negative/rate Suspected reaction/rate Weak positive/rate Strong positive/rate Very strong positive/rate Positive rate
Example 4 30/100% 0/0 0/0 0/0 0/0 0
Example 5 30/100% 0/0 0/0 0/0 0/0 0
Example 6 30/100% 0/0 0/0 0/0 0/0 0
Comparative example 14 16/53.33% 12/40% 2/6.67% 0/0 0/0 46.67%
Comparative example 15 28/93.33% 2/6.67% 0/0 0/0 0/0 6.67%
As can be seen from the table above, the oil-controlling and acne-removing condensation prepared in the embodiments 4-6 of the invention has low skin sensitization, and no positive reaction is detected in 30 subjects, which indicates that the composition has no stimulation to skin, mild components and safety.
